Output 08bfb326d221d655840a28a7f00a8a5f67aea0ec65b085a9d2f0b32fb757d50a:0

value
197989
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e350337d85fa54062ee13beb34876258d2b8f74e OP_EQUALVERIFY OP_CHECKSIG
address
1MivU23XjiQEBdNXaWRGX9KfaZRXpD4VLD
transaction
08bfb326d221d655840a28a7f00a8a5f67aea0ec65b085a9d2f0b32fb757d50a
spent
true